Made of Bricks by Kate Nash

I really like this album, it’s very good in what it does, I can’t wait until it finally comes out in the United States. What really got me into it was how she can just say anything she wants, expressing every bad word you could probably think of.

Some of my favorite tracks include “Birds”, “ Mariella”, and “Merry Happy/Little Red,” none which have been released as singles. If “Birds” didn’t have the main word being sh*t, I think it would make a brilliant, sweet single.
